The Art and Science Behind the Surgery

A laminectomy is essentially a decompression operation—think of it as widening the road to ease traffic flow. Surgeons remove the lamina, the back part of a vertebra that covers your spinal canal, to relieve pressure on the spinal cord or nerves. This relief can be a game-changer for those suffering from spinal stenosis, herniated discs, or other causes of nerve compression.

Is Laminectomy Surgery Risky or Routine? The Real Talk

Here’s the kicker: no surgery is without risk, and laminectomy is no exception. Complications can range from infection to nerve damage, but with advances in surgical techniques, outcomes have improved dramatically. Many NJ spine surgeons embrace minimally invasive methods, which can mean shorter recovery times and less post-op discomfort. Curious about the latest trends? How Do Surgeons Balance Risk and Benefit When Recommending Laminectomy?

This pivotal question requires a nuanced understanding. Surgeons in New Jersey evaluate not only the anatomical severity of nerve compression but also the patient’s overall health, lifestyle demands, and treatment goals. The decision to proceed involves weighing potential complications—such as infection, dural tears, or postoperative instability—against the debilitating impact of untreated nerve compression.

Moreover, incorporating patient preferences and expectations during shared decision-making is crucial. Precision in Patient Selection: Tailoring Laminectomy for Optimal Outcomes

One of the often underappreciated facets of effective laminectomy surgery lies in meticulous patient selection. New Jersey spine surgeons employ advanced diagnostic modalities, including high-resolution MRI and dynamic CT myelography, to delineate not only the extent of bony and soft tissue encroachment but also to assess spinal stability and neural element viability. This granular imaging allows for a bespoke surgical plan that minimizes unnecessary tissue disruption while maximizing decompression efficacy.

Additionally, patient comorbidities such as osteoporosis, diabetes, or coagulopathies are rigorously evaluated, as these factors can significantly impact both intraoperative decision-making and postoperative healing trajectories. Preoperative optimization, including bone density enhancement and glycemic control, is increasingly recognized as a cornerstone for reducing surgical morbidity.

Innovative Surgical Adjuncts: Enhancing Visualization and Safety in Laminectomy

Beyond the traditional microscope, emerging technologies such as intraoperative navigation systems and augmented reality (AR) overlays are revolutionizing the precision of laminectomy procedures. These tools enable real-time anatomical mapping, which is particularly valuable in complex cases involving multi-level stenosis or anatomical anomalies.

Furthermore, neuromonitoring techniques, including electromyography (EMG) and somatosensory evoked potentials (SSEPs), provide continuous feedback on nerve function during decompression, allowing surgeons to adjust their approach proactively to prevent iatrogenic injury. The integration of these technologies exemplifies the commitment of NJ surgeons to harnessing innovation for superior patient safety and outcomes.

How Does Neuromonitoring Impact the Risk Profile of Laminectomy?

Neuromonitoring serves as a critical safeguard during laminectomy by providing instantaneous data on the functional integrity of spinal nerves. According to a detailed analysis published in the Spine Journal, the use of intraoperative neuromonitoring correlates with a statistically significant reduction in postoperative neurological deficits, especially in high-risk or revision surgeries.

By alerting the surgical team to potential neural compromise before permanent damage occurs, neuromonitoring facilitates immediate corrective actions, enhancing the safety margin of what can be a delicate decompressive maneuver.

Rehabilitation Redefined: Integrating Technology and Therapy Post-Laminectomy

Postoperative rehabilitation is evolving beyond conventional physical therapy. In New Jersey, spine centers are increasingly adopting technology-enhanced rehabilitation programs incorporating wearable sensors and tele-rehabilitation platforms. These innovations allow clinicians to monitor patient progress remotely, adjust therapy intensity dynamically, and provide real-time feedback, all of which contribute to more personalized and effective recovery pathways.

Moreover, emerging evidence supports the role of neuroplasticity-focused interventions, such as task-specific training and proprioceptive exercises, in accelerating functional restoration after nerve decompression surgeries like laminectomy. NJ experts advocate for early initiation of such programs under careful supervision to optimize neurological recovery and prevent secondary complications.

What Are the Criteria for Selecting Robotic-Assisted Laminectomy Over Traditional Methods?

Choosing between robotic-assisted and conventional laminectomy approaches involves a multifactorial assessment. NJ spine specialists consider factors such as the complexity and location of stenosis, patient anatomy, prior surgeries, and comorbid conditions. Robotic assistance is particularly advantageous in cases requiring high precision or in patients who may benefit from reduced invasiveness and faster recovery.

However, candidacy also depends on institutional availability and surgeon expertise. According to a study published in The Journal of Spine Surgery, patients undergoing robotic-assisted laminectomy demonstrated lower complication rates and improved early functional outcomes compared to traditional open surgery, emphasizing the potential benefits of this technology when appropriately applied.

Economic Considerations: Balancing Cutting-Edge Care with Costs in NJ Spine Surgery

While technological advancements promise enhanced surgical precision and recovery, the economic implications cannot be overlooked. The costs associated with robotic-assisted laminectomy remain higher than conventional methods due to equipment and training expenses. Patients and providers in New Jersey must consider insurance coverage, out-of-pocket costs, and long-term value when determining the best surgical pathway.
